Polish Prime Minister Donald Tusk emphasized the need for an honest conversation with Ukraine. The talks between the heads of the Ministries of Foreign Affairs of Poland and Ukraine in Warsaw were aimed at reducing tensions in bilateral relations.

Poland and Ukraine need an honest conversation, not an escalation of tensions - Tusk

Polish Prime Minister Donald Tusk called on Warsaw and Kyiv to engage in honest dialogue without escalating tensions. His statement came amid talks between the foreign ministers of Poland and Ukraine following a series of disputes in bilateral relations, UNN reports, citing Polish Radio.

Details

"It is worth looking for ways to have an honest conversation, rather than escalating tensions," Prime Minister Tusk commented on the talks between the foreign ministers of Poland and Ukraine.

During a press conference, the head of the Polish government stated that he counts on cooperation with Kyiv.

"I am receiving signals that the Ukrainian side has realized: it is worth looking for ways to have an honest conversation, including about the past, and it is not worth escalating this tension. We will see, this is probably a long process. But, as you know, I am convinced that good Ukrainian-Polish relations are in the interests of both sides. At the same time, this requires goodwill from Kyiv. It cannot be that only Warsaw constantly demonstrates goodwill. But I would like this firm position not to be marked by contempt or hostility, because this, undoubtedly, will not lead to anything constructive," Tusk said.

A meeting between Polish Foreign Minister Radosław Sikorski and Ukrainian Foreign Minister Andrii Sybiha took place at the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Poland in Warsaw.

The talks took place after a series of tensions in Polish-Ukrainian relations. The talks in Warsaw are seen as an attempt to reduce tensions and restore constructive historical dialogue between the two countries.

As PAP reports, the meeting between Sikorski and Sybiha in Warsaw ended without comments from the Ukrainian delegation. According to previous reports, the topics of the talks between the two ministers were to include Polish-Ukrainian relations and the situation at the front. On Wednesday, the PAP agency, as stated, "unofficially learned that the Ukrainians are seeking a meeting with the Polish side." 

Recall

President of Poland Karol Nawrocki decided to strip President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elenskyy of the Order of the White Eagle and emphasized that there are limits in Polish-Ukrainian relations that cannot be crossed.

The decision was made after Nawrocki stated that he is critical of the decision of President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elenskyy to name a Ukrainian Special Operations Forces unit after the "Heroes of the UPA".

President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elenskyy granted one of the units of the Special Operations Forces of the Armed Forces of Ukraine the name "Heroes of the UPA" at the end of May.

The Order of the White Eagle was awarded to Volodymyr Zelenskyy in 2023 by the then President of Poland Andrzej Duda.

Zelenskyy sent the Order of the White Eagle back to the President of Poland via "Nova Poshta".

Later, Poland criticized Ukraine's decision to create a National Pantheon.
